As the Controls, Compliance, Risk & Audit (CCRA) Senior Finance Data Analyst, you will play a pivotal role in ensuring our organization's commitment to identify and appropriately manage risk while simultaneously helping drive a best-in-class operating environment. Leading the development and implementation of a comprehensive internal controls and compliance reporting and data analytics strategy, you will utilize advanced technology to drive companywide decision making that appropriately balances the customer, cost and control needs of the organization. Collaborating with key stakeholders across the company and collaborating with CCRA teams will be integral to the success of this role.

We are looking for someone who has a keen interest in data and reporting and wants to join a team helping drive firmwide insights and outcomes. As key a member of the CCRA function, you will join a team to develop insights and strategies that enable strategic, risk based decision making across GEICO. This role will manage the data gathering, analysis and reporting data of controls, audit compliance and key business activities and outcomes throughout the organization providing insight regarding business products, services, and processes and ensuring the appropriate understanding and management of all risk types including operational, technology, financial and reputational.


Responsibilities:

  • Manage the data collection, analysis, and reporting of key risk management activities, such as audits, assessments, remediation, and complaints

  • Develop and maintain a suite of reporting, dashboards and metrics using multiple complex data sources and various tools and systems, such as Excel, Power BI, and SQL

  • Ensure the quality, accuracy and consistency of reporting and data, and implement data governance and validation processes

  • Provide senior/board/regulatory level reports and insights clearly and succinctly articulating the core strategic messages with the appropriate level of supporting data

  • Provide insights and recommendations based on data analysis and trends, and identify areas of improvement and best practices

  • Coordinate with other compliance managers, control leaders, internal auditors, and business/functional stakeholders to ensure timely and accurate delivery of control/compliance information

  • Establish and maintain data governance, quality and security standards, policies, and procedures

  • Perform the design, development and maintenance of data and analytics platforms, tools, and solutions; understand emerging capabilities and be forward thinking regarding their deployment and internal use

  • Ensure data availability, reliability, scalability, and performance
